It is still apparent that there is bad blood between current UFC Women’s Bantamweight Champion Miesha Tate and former champion Ronda Rousey, but it looks like Rousey has a problem with another fighter. On the Joe Rogan’s podcast “The Joe Rogan Experience,” Tate recalled a story told to her by straweight fighter Paige Van Zant.
“So Paige was also at that VIP party, and Paige and I have spoke, we’re friendly. Don’t know her that well. Anyway, she felt the need, she came up to me like ‘Miesha Miesha Miesha, I have to tell you this experience I had with Ronda.’ I’m like ‘Oh, what?’ And she’s like ‘Well we were at a Reebok deal just recently, and we were at a shoot, and I was trying to find her so we could get a picture, and the Reebok people were like ‘Don’t ask Ronda for a picture.” She was like ‘Why?’ They were like ‘Don’t, just stay away from Ronda, don’t ask her for a picture.’ She was like ‘Okay…’.
And I guess Ronda came later that day and seeked her out. And just cussed her out. They’ve never really had a conversation either. She’s like ‘I don’t know Ronda other than hi, bye.’ That’s it. I guess she came up, Ronda came up and was like ‘F**k you, you fairweathered bitch. How dare you cross me.’ She (Paige) was like ‘Cross you? What are you talking about?’ And she (Rousey) is like ‘You congratulated Holly Holm for beating me, so f**k you, you f**king fairweathered 115-pound…”. She just went off on Paige.”
TMZ reached out to VanZant about the incident and she confirmed the story. “It appears that I offended Ronda by congratulating Holly after her victory. The incident was very shocking and totally unnecessary,” said VanZant. TMZ reached out to Rousey as well, but were unable to get a response.
